The conference announcing the launch of the “Woman, Life, Freedom Inclusive Network” is now taking place as part of the effort to form a “Coordination and Leadership Council.” I’ll write more about this later.
This initiative was formed in response to a call from inside the country in June 2025 to create a “Coordination and Leadership Council,” and it presents itself as a continuation of two earlier texts: the “Charter of Minimum Demands of Independent Trade Union and Civil Organizations in Iran” and the “Charter of the Progressive Demands of Women in Iran.”
The main goal is to hold a broad national conference to create a pluralist political alternative in the path toward overthrowing the Islamic Republic and moving through a transition period.
The charter says the council is meant to build a link between forces inside and outside the country, prevent top-down political projects and the return of individual-centered or one-party structures, and create the conditions for coordinated political action.
In its basic principles, it also stresses the complete end of the Islamic Republic, the end of sexual and gender apartheid, the abolition of execution and torture, the freedom of all political and conscience prisoners, unconditional freedom of thought and expression, separation of religion from the state, and equal rights without discrimination.
In explaining the nature of this council, the charter says that “leadership” here means collective guidance based on the combined strength of different forces, not concentration of power or acting as a guardian over others. It also defines cooperation in this framework as voluntary.
Each group keeps its political and organizational independence, sharing resources is optional, and in case of disagreement, the principle is dialogue and voluntary withdrawal, not binding commitment. This document was drafted in January 2026.
